Synopsis
One hundred and fifty years after she lived and wrote, Jane Austen has become, in the words of Variety, magazine, a worldwide mega celebrity. How did this unmarried poor relation from a middle-class family of clergymen come to write the passionate, witty novels about love and money that have made her one of the most popular writers of all time? How much of what she wrote was taken from what she really lived? Austen's obstinacy made escape impossible -- she would not consider marrying without love. She died poor and single, and thought of her books as her children.Taking a fresh and perceptive look at Jane Austen's life and undoubted genius, Valerie Grosvenor Myer draws on Austen's letters, family papers, and other candid accounts by her friends and relatives to bring this humorous, lovable woman to life. Jane Austen: Obstinate Heart is a delightful and entertaining portrait that will appeal to Austen fans of all walks.
